Latest Patents

James L. Fuller holds a patent for an "Apparatus and method for identification and recognition of an item." This invention utilizes ultrasonic imaging to analyze material microfeatures and macrofeatures within the bulk volume of a material. The method involves ultrasonic interrogation and imaging, where only reflected ultrasonic energy from a preselected plane or volume is accepted. An initial interrogation establishes an identification reference, and subsequent scans are statistically compared to this reference to determine match or non-match decisions.
